On behalf of the Bladen County Educational Foundation, Inc., I would like to take this opportunity to publicly thank everyone who participated in our “Jail-A-Thon.” Your efforts and generous donations helped us raise nearly $5,000 to date, to assist the students and educators in the Bladen County Public School System.

The outpouring of support and assistance was more than we had expected and I truly believe that everyone who participated and allowed himself or herself to be arrested thoroughly enjoyed the process.
